Solution Overview

Problem

Existing distributed traffic engineering technologies face challenges in managing network congestion, as they rely on shortest path algorithms that do not adapt to changing link conditions, leading to increased link load and affected data flow transmission quality.

Innovation Solution

A network optimization method that involves monitoring communications links for abnormal states, adjusting metrics of data flows based on service level agreements (SLA) and priority information, and dynamically rerouting data flows to alleviate congestion and reduce link load.

AI summary

Embodiments of this application provide a network optimization method, a network optimization system, and a network device, and relate to the communications field. The method includes: A first network device adjusts, if it is detected that a communications link between the first network device and a second network device is in an abnormal state, a metric of at least one data flow received by the first network device; and the first network device selects a transmission path for the at least one data flow based on adjusted metric, and transmits the at least one data flow to the selected transmission path. In this way, load of the communications link is reduced, and the communications link is restored to a normal state.
